ARBOR HOUSE COMMUNITY RESIDENCE | OSWEGO COUNTY OPPORTUNITIES (OCO)

Eligibility
Individuals ages 18 years and older in need of chemical dependence services; must be considered homeless or living in an environment that is not conducive to recovery
Hours
Administrative hours: Monday - Friday, 8:30 AM - 4:30 PM Services provided 24 hours / 7 days
Application process
Physician referral required
Fees
Call for fee information
Service area
Oswego County, New York

Provides a 16-bed community residence for individuals in recovery from chemical dependence. Offers 24/7 supervision.
